Fried Pickle Dip Recipe

A creamy and tangy Fried Pickle Dip featuring toasted panko breadcrumbs, chopped pickles, and a zesty ranch seasoning blend, perfect as a flavorful appetizer or snack.

Ingredients

Scale

For the Dip

  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1/2 cup panko breadcrumbs
  • 1 cup chopped pickles
  • 2 cups sour cream
  • 1 1.5-ounce packet ranch seasoning
  • 1/4 cup pickle juice

For Garnish (Optional)

  • Dill, for topping

Instructions

  1. Toast the Panko: Melt the butter in a large skillet over medium-low heat. Add the panko breadcrumbs and stir frequently until they are golden brown and toasted, about 3-4 minutes. Remove from heat.
  2. Prepare the Mix: Reserve some of the toasted panko and some chopped pickles for topping. In a bowl, combine the remaining toasted panko, chopped pickles, sour cream, ranch seasoning packet, and pickle juice. Stir until all ingredients are well mixed.
  3. Serve Immediately: If enjoying right away, transfer the dip to a serving bowl. Top with the reserved chopped pickles, toasted panko, and fresh dill if desired.
  4. Make Ahead and Store: If preparing ahead, place the dip (without toppings) in an airtight container and refrigerate. When ready to serve, transfer to a serving bowl and add the reserved chopped pickles, toasted panko, and dill as garnish.

Notes

  • To add extra flavor and texture, garnish with fresh dill or your preferred herbs.
  • This dip pairs wonderfully with chips, crackers, or fresh vegetable sticks.
  • For a spicier kick, consider adding a dash of hot sauce or finely chopped jalapeños to the dip mixture.
  • Storing the toppings separately keeps them from becoming soggy, maintaining their crunch.
  • Adjust the amount of pickle juice based on your preferred tartness.
